BWW Review: Musical LYSON GASTER NO BOROGODO Pays Tribute to Acclaimed Revue Theater Actress
by Claudio Erlichman - Dec 4, 2019

The play portrays the career of actress Lyson Gaster, stage name of Augustine Belber Pastor, Spanish created in Piracicaba, who with his revue theater company traveled Brazil in the 1920s, 30s and 40s to great success. The show stays until December 15 at Teatro Alfredo Mesquita, then continues season from January 18 to February 15 at the Teatro Italia.

Photo Flash: Get a Look at Costume Sketches From THE PRINCE OF EGYPT
by Stephi Wild - Dec 4, 2019

THE PRINCE OF EGYPT has released the first costume sketches by the Tony Award®-winning Broadway designer Ann Hould-Ward. The new stage musical, with music and lyrics by Stephen Schwartz (Wicked, Godspell), a book by Philip LaZebnik (Mulan, Pocahontas) and based on the celebrated DreamWorks Animation film, features a stunning collection of over 380 costumes and 250 pairs of shoes and begins performances at London's Dominion Theatre on Wednesday 5 February 2020.

Ensemble Theatre Cincinnati to Present THE FROG PRINCESS
by Chloe Rabinowitz - Dec 2, 2019

The ribbit-ing return of Ensemble Theatre's first commissioned family-friendly musical, The Frog Princess, leaps to the stage December 4, 2019-January 4, 2020. This musical spin on the beloved classic Russian fairy tale celebrates the beauty within each of us and receives a contemporary twist by local creative team Joseph McDonough (playwright) and David Kisor (composer and lyricist). This year's production is the first time it will have appeared on the ETC stage in twelve years. With a revitalized script, intricate costumes, and a lavish set, The Frog Princess is holiday fun for the entire family! Directed by D. Lynn Meyers.

Stockton Civic Theatre Presents Roald Dahl's MATILDA The Musical
by Julie Musbach - Oct 4, 2019

Stockton Civic Theatre presents Matilda the Musical, a magical romp that will thrill adults and children alike with catchy songs and high energy dance numbers. Based on the beloved children's novel by Roald Dahl, Matilda the Musical is the story of a precocious young girl who overcomes the obstacles of a totally dysfunctional family who don't understand her and the tyrannical behavior of a cruel headmistress. Armed with a vivid imagination and the power of telekinesis, Matilda boldly changes her destiny with the help of a loving teacher, Miss Honey.

Segal Centre Presents The North American Premiere Of MYTHIC
by A.A. Cristi - Sep 25, 2019

The Segal Centre is proud to continue its mission of developing and premiering new musical theatre works with top Canadian talent with a new pop/rock musical about the Greek goddess Persephone. Directed by Brian Hill and featuring a high-energy score filled with epic anthems by Marcus Stevens and Oran Eldor, the North American premiere of Mythic will be in the Sylvan Adams Theatre from October 27 to November 17, 2019.
